Threat actors bought sponsored Google Search ads that point to a Google Sites lure impersonating an OpenAI Codex download; macOS users are instructed to paste a Terminal command that decodes and pipes remote content to zsh, launching a three-stage loader that removes quarantine attributes and executes a universal Mach-O payload. Cato Networks links the campaign to AMOS-like delivery patterns (base64 curl loaders, xattr -c, /tmp/helper staging and telemetry at api/metrics/run?event=pasted) and identifies iframe and payload hosts (e.g., bright-links.com, trekmesh15.com, grove-12.com); defenders are advised to restrict risky CLI execution, monitor for curl | zsh and xattr -c behavior, and block known malicious iframe infrastructure.
